Look at the nice sandy slope of that beach. There are bathrooms to change in and an outdoor shower to rise off the salt. It's the perfect place for a swim, right? Wrong! Before you dive in, take a look the view from that beach:


It's a stunning peaceful marina, but marinas and swimming beaches do not go well together. That water is disgusting. It's full of engine oil and sewage. Stay out!

But that's no reason to stay away from Eagle Harbour. There's big rocks to climb on, little rocks to look for crabs under, you can make sandcastles on the beach, and the view alone is worth the trip.
